What you’ll be doing

As a Graduate Civil Engineer (Aviation) in our Pavement & Asset Management Practice, you’ll be immersed in a variety of projects and gain experience in the design, assessment, and delivery of civil engineering projects within the Aviation sector. You’ll be involved in the full lifecycle of aviation civil and pavement schemes, from early-stage feasibility and design through to construction support. Your work will include projects such as runway and taxiway rehabilitation, apron upgrades, and airfield asset management. You’ll collaborate with experienced engineers, asset managers, and specialists in material and digital disciplines.

  • Support the design and delivery of airfield civil and pavement schemes across various airports
  • Assist with materials selection, structural design, and lifecycle planning
  • Conduct site inspections, surveys, and condition assessments
  •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ams including highways and asset management specialists
  • Use industry-standard software and tools to model and analyse pavement performance
  • Contribute to technical reports, proposals, and client presentations
  • Ensure compliance with aviation standards, safety regulations, and sustainability goals
